Home > Syntax Error > Basic Syntax Error Expected Sub

Basic Syntax Error Expected Sub


Do you have any ideas what I did wrong? The project file 'item1' contains invalid key 'item2'. It is to be noted that an error-handling routine is not a procedure (Sub or Function) but a section of code marked by a line label or a line number. Would you like to add a reference to the containing library now? navigate here

This code is used by the vendor to identify the error caused. Here is an example: Private Sub cmdCalculate_Click() On Error GoTo ThereWasBadCalculation Dim HourlySalary As Double, WeeklyTime As Double Dim WeeklySalary As Double ' One of these two lines could produce an The Description argument describes the error providing additional information about it. Can't write object because it does not support persistence.

Syntax Error Expected End Of Line But Found Identifier

To get the error description, after inquiring about the error number, you can get the equivalent Description value. Item' could not be registered 'item' designers can only be used in DLL projects 'item' designers cannot be private 'item' designers cannot be public in ActiveX EXE projects 'item' designers must Here is an example that tests the result of 275.85 + 88.26: One of the most basic actions you can perform in the Immediate window consists of testing a built-in function. Use thereof is explained in our trademark policy unless otherwise noted.

Line 'item1': Property 'item2' in 'item3' could not be loaded. As its name indicates, a run-time error occurs when the program runs; that is, after you have created your application. more hot questions question feed lang-vb about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Technology Life / Arts Culture / Recreation Syntax Error Expected Global Temporary Before asking the compiler to resume, to provide an alternative solution (a number in this case), you can re-initialize the variable that caused the error.

Note that if the procedure is defined as Private, it can only be called from within its module. The Error Number As mentioned already, there are various types of errors that can occur to your program. Line 'item1': The CLSID 'item2' for 'item3' is invalid. Problems are divided in two broad categories.

An error was encountered loading a property. Syntax Error Expected Something Between The Word Here is an example: Private Sub cmdCalculate_Click() ThereWasBadCalculation: MsgBox "There was a problem when performing the calculation" End Sub If you simply create a label and its message like this, its Privacy policy About LibreOffice Help Disclaimers Error Handling Handling Errors Introduction to Errors A computer application is supposed to run as smooth as possible. You can raise either a pre-defined error using its corresponding error number, or generate a custom (user-defined) error.

Syntax Error Expected After This Token

Refer to 'item' for details Errors occurred during load Event handler is invalid Event not found Exit Do not within Do...Loop Exit For not within For...Next Exit Function not allowed in Line 'item1': Can't set checked property in menu 'item2'. Syntax Error Expected End Of Line But Found Identifier This action will reset your project, proceed anyway? Syntax Error Expected Ident For Declaration Name Got Literal Thank you for this fantastic resource - by producing it you have made it possible to programme in OO_Basic ... ( An otherwise daunting and mystifying process ).Greg McC, Liverpool, UKSelected

Unfortunately, this is not always the case. check over here The library containing this symbol is not referenced by the current project, so the symbol is undefined. There are two (2) ways to fix Openoffice Basic Syntax Error Expected Sub Error: Advanced Computer User Solution (manual update): 1) Start your computer and log on as an administrator. The property settings of the Err object relate to the most recent run-time error, so it is important that your error-handling routine saves these values before the occurrence of another error. Syntax Error Expected Something Like A Name Or A Unicode Delimited Identifier

Your feedback about this content is important.Let us know what you think. you often enter Application.EnableEvents = False at the beginning of the code  for a worksheet_change event and because EnableEvents is not automatically changed back to True you add Application.EnableEvents = True Is the empty set homeomorphic to itself? http://onlinetvsoftware.net/syntax-error/basic-syntax-error-symbol-expected.php This property holds a (usually short) message about the error number.

Fortunately, the Code Editor is equipped to know all keywords of the Visual Basic language. Syntax Error Expected Expression Got End Of Script Note: This article was updated on 2016-09-26 and previously published under WIKI_Q210794 Contents 1.What is Openoffice Basic Syntax Error Expected Sub error? 2.What causes Openoffice Basic Syntax Error Expected Sub error? Maybe someone else will show up and rescue you –user2140173 Feb 25 '14 at 14:53 add a comment| 1 Answer 1 active oldest votes up vote 1 down vote accepted Solution:

You may want to generate a custom error when your code does something you don't want, for example, to prevent a user from inputting data which may be outside an acceptable

If PayrollEmployeeNumber = "" Then ' ... The HelpFile and HelpContext arguments represent the help file and help context ID used to link help to the error message box.     Raise Custom Errors (user-defined errors) using the fill out that record with values from the time sheet Worksheets("Payroll").Cells(CurrentRow, 2) = TimeSheetEmployeeNumber Worksheets("Payroll").Cells(CurrentRow, 3) = StartDate Worksheets("Payroll").Cells(CurrentRow, 4) = EndDate Worksheets("Payroll").Cells(CurrentRow, 5) = Week1Monday Worksheets("Payroll").Cells(CurrentRow, 6) = Week1Tuesday Worksheets("Payroll").Cells(CurrentRow, Syntax Error Expected An Indented Block Other examples when a run-time error can occur are: on using incorrect variable names or variable types; if your code goes into an infinite loop; using a value or reference outside

In the case of an arithmetic calculation, imagine we know that the problem was caused by the user typing an invalid number (such as typing a name where a number was To display the Immediate window, on the main menu of Microsoft Visual Basic, you can click View -> Immediate Window. Line 'item1': Property 'item2' in control 'item3' had an invalid property index. weblink You can activate and deactivate a breakpoint by selecting Active from its context menu.

Do you want to save the changes now? In reality, a program can face various categories of bad occurrences. Line 'item1': The file 'item2' could not be loaded. After an error has occurred, to ask the compiler to proceed with the regular flow of the program, type the Resume keyword.

Line 'item1': The Form or MDIForm name 'item2' is not valid; can't load this form. When your program runs and encounters a problem, it may stop and display the number of the error. Openoffice Basic Syntax Error Expected Sub Error Codes are caused in one way or another by misconfigured system files in your windows operating system. To add a variable to the list of watched variables, type the variable name in the Watch text box and press Enter.

Errors are easily traced since you can immediately see the result of each step. The Err object's Raise method is useful to regenerate an original error in a vba procedure - if an error occurs within an active error handler which does not correct for